Episode 33

How to Read the (Actual) Bible with Children

Featuring Colleen Vermeulen

August 31, 2023 | 50 min.

Three years ago, Colleen Vermeulen and her husband decided to do something radical: read “the real Bible with all its words” daily with their young children. Following a pattern based loosely on the Liturgy of the Hours, their family prayer time is now grounded in Scripture and is feeding the kids’ growing relationships with Jesus. Listen to this episode to hear how they did this and why. Colleen gives four practical tips for reading the Bible with children and shares advice on everything from facing the fidgets to helping kids hear God speak to them.

Colleen Reiss Vermeulen is executive director and instructor at the Catholic Biblical School of Michigan and teaches occasional classes for Notre Dame’s McGrath Institute for Church Life. The mother of four also serves in the US Army Reserve. She wrote several book introductions and reflections for the Living the Word Catholic Women’s Bible. Take Colleen’s favorite Scripture to your next Holy Hour

Pray: Come, Holy Spirit, open my heart and mind to hear your word today.

Read the Word: 1 John 3:1–2

(Read it in your own Bible to get the context, and so you can make notes)

“See what love the Father has given us, that we should be called children of God; and so we are. The reason why the world does not know us is that it did not know him.  Beloved, we are God’s children now; it does not yet appear what we shall be, but we know that when he appears we shall be like him, for we shall see him as he is.”

Ponder the Word: Read several times, lingering where it touches your heart. What catches your attention? What do you hear the Lord saying to you?

Pray with the Word: Bring to the Lord what you have heard, and talk to him about it. Ask for his grace. Thank him for his loving care.

Live the Word: How does what you read touch your life? What can you do this week to put it into practice?
